    Hayward Panel out again!

    It seems like about every other year my Hayward Swimpure SWG panel goes on the fritz. Each time it’s the same- no power except for the LCD, but if I throw the breaker and back the power goes on until it tries to start generating. The last time I researched the issue to a thermsistor and...
